Doro Headrest System
1. Base Unit
The DORO® Base Unit can be used with all standard operating tables. The brackets and connecting tube are adjusted during installation. The mechanical design of the base handle assembly has been completely modified in order to eliminate the typical problems often encountered with existing systems. The new design
prevents damage to the cast housing or to the rod in the unit due to incorrect handling of the mechanical components and also eliminates the danger of inadvertent opening of the mechanical system during surgery.
2. Cross Bars
This component allows you to use the Skull Clamp in applications requiring a sitting position of the patient. It is mounted to the side rails of the operating table. The unit is suitable for all standard operating tables.
3. Skull Clamp Adaptor

4. Skull Clamp
A modification of the mechanical system for the Skull Pin holder has considerably improved the stability of the Skull Clamp as compared to the conventional systems.
Since navigation systems are increasingly used in surgery, this is of particular importance. Other systems do not meet these requirements.
5. The Multi Purpose Skull Clamp
The Multi Purpose Skull Clamp allows an invasive as well as an non-invasive fixation of the patient's head. Skull pins and a range of elastic pads can be adapted to the fixation carriers in a modular way. Suitable for children and adults.
6. The Head Support
The Head Support represents an additional component of the DORO Headrest System. It can be adjusted in all planes to bring the pads of skull pins in the desired position. This device makes the patient handling and care much easier and is providing additional safety beside the 3-point fixation of the skull clamp.
7. Non-invasive horseshoe headrest
This component is used instead of the invasive Skull Clamp. Versions for children and adults are available. Elastic pads are providing the best possible pressure relief.
8. Gel Head Rest for OR-Tables
Gel Headrests and Gel Head Rings are available in different sizes and forms. They savely protect head, neck, face and ears during surgery.
